Khakas

Etymology

Borrowed from Russian кaза́къ (kazák, Cossack, in post-reform orthography каза́к) or коза́къ (kozák, in post-reform orthography коза́к). Compare also Shor қазақ (k̂azak̂, Russian).

Noun

хазах (xazax)

  1. Russian (person)
    Synonym: орыс (orıs)

Mongolian

Etymology

Proto-Mongolic *kaja-, compare Dongxiang ghazha (to gnaw).

Pronunciation

Verb

хазах (xazax) (Mongolian spelling ᠬᠠᠵᠠᠬᠤ (qaǰaqu))

  1. to bite
  2. to grip, to clamp (with pliers or a similar tool)
